What Do BPO Companies in the Philippines Offer?

BPO providers handle specific business functions on behalf of their clients. The services offered depend on the provider’s expertise and the requirements of the business.

Common BPO services include:

  • Customer service and customer support
  • Technical support
  • Data entry and processing
  • Administrative assistance
  • Accounting support
  • Quality assurance
  • Content moderation
  • Lead research and mining
  • Transcription
  • Virtual assistance

Working with BPO companies in the Philippines allows businesses to delegate operational responsibilities while their internal teams concentrate on strategic priorities and core business activities.

Why Businesses Choose the Philippines for BPO

The Philippines has developed extensive experience in the global outsourcing sector. Many Filipino professionals have experience working with international businesses and supporting customers and teams across different markets.

English communication is another factor considered by businesses when evaluating the country as an outsourcing destination. Professional communication can help outsourced teams collaborate with internal departments and interact with customers.

Cost efficiency and scalability can also be important considerations. Rather than building every department internally, companies can work with an external provider and establish teams according to their operational requirements.

Types of BPO Services Businesses Can Outsource

Outsourcing does not have to involve an entire department. Companies can select individual processes or combine several functions based on their needs.

Back-office operations are commonly outsourced because they involve repetitive or specialized activities that require consistent attention. Data processing, administrative work, accounting, quality assurance, and content moderation are examples.

Customer-facing operations can also be outsourced. These may include customer service, technical assistance, and help desk functions.

How to Choose the Right BPO Provider

Selecting an outsourcing partner requires a clear understanding of business requirements. Before approaching providers, companies should identify the processes they want to outsource, expected workloads, required skills, working hours, communication requirements, and performance expectations.

Businesses should also review a provider’s recruitment and training process. A structured approach to hiring and employee development can contribute to consistent service delivery.

Scalability is another important consideration. A business may initially need a small team but require additional resources as operations grow. Providers that can accommodate changing requirements may offer greater flexibility.

Creating Effective Outsourcing Solutions

Successful outsourcing depends on more than selecting a provider. Businesses should establish clear processes, responsibilities, communication channels, reporting systems, and performance standards.

Regular communication between the client and outsourcing team can help identify process improvements and address operational challenges. Clear documentation is also useful because it gives outsourced professionals a consistent understanding of their responsibilities.
